Description
The Finite Difference Time Domain method (FDTD) uses centre-difference representations of the continuous partial differential equations to create iterative numerical models of wave propagation. Initially developed for electromagnetic
problems the technique has potential application in acoustic prediction. In this paper the time reversal electromagnetic simulation has been discussed. That work is based on the sensor management for a room The reversal time for sensor from the different source of transmission could be viewed on the MATLAB command window. This research aims to develop the signal processing of the sensor management within 3 meters around signal source.
